A 5% pale with a stripped back grain bill but hopped up with the classics: Simcoe, Columbus, Chinook & Centennial. Soft, juicy & dank, just how we like it!
Malt: Extra Pale, Dextrin, Caramalt
Hops: Simcoe, Columbus, Chinook, Centennial
Yeast: London Ale III

Can. StarmoreBoss, Sheffield. Fully opaque, medium gold. Whipped egg white for a head. Nose has candied peel. Weed. Some herbal notes erring on bath salts. Clean malts. No oats! Taste is fairly dry and and weed like, herbal oil bitter. Light to medium body. Bright carbonation. More of the herbal bitterness to finish. First Verdant in ages, and this is great.

Keg at The Experiment - Hackney. Pours murky gold with a frothy, pure white head. Excellent stuff, nice and juicy, soft rindy bitterness, pale bread, moderate sweetness. Light bodied with average, massaging carbonation. Smooth and juicy citrusy finish. Wonderful.
